合思发票智能校验系统开发解决方案通常包括以下几个核心步骤:1、需求分析,2、系统设计,3、技术实现,4、测试与部署,5、持续优化。其中需求分析是最为重要的一步,它直接决定了项目的方向和目标。
需求分析:在开发合思发票智能校验系统时,首先需要明确系统的功能需求和用户需求。这包括确定系统需要处理的发票类型、校验的规则和标准、用户交互界面设计等。通过与潜在用户和相关利益方进行深入沟通,了解他们的具体需求和痛点,从而制定出切实可行的系统需求文档。这一步不仅能帮助开发团队明确方向,还能避免后期的返工和改动,提高开发效率。
一、需求分析
在需求分析阶段,需要重点关注以下几个方面:
- 发票类型:确定系统需要处理的发票类型,如增值税专用发票、普通发票、电子发票等。
- 校验规则:定义系统需要执行的校验规则,包括发票号码、金额、税率、开票日期等信息的准确性校验。
- 用户角色:识别系统的用户角色,如财务人员、审核员等,并明确他们的权限和操作流程。
- 数据安全:考虑发票数据的安全性,制定相关的数据加密和权限控制策略。
- 用户界面:设计用户友好的界面,确保系统易于操作,提高用户的使用体验。
通过详细的需求分析,可以确保系统的开发方向正确,满足用户的实际需求。
二、系统设计
系统设计是开发发票智能校验系统的关键步骤,通常包括以下几个部分:
- 系统架构设计:选择适合的系统架构,如微服务架构、单体架构等,确保系统具有良好的扩展性和稳定性。
- 数据库设计:设计合理的数据库结构,确保数据的存储和查询效率。
- 接口设计:定义系统与其他系统或模块的接口,确保数据的互通和共享。
- 流程设计:设计系统的业务流程,确保各个功能模块之间的协调和配合。
- 安全设计:制定系统的安全策略,确保数据的安全和隐私保护。
三、技术实现
在技术实现阶段,需要选择合适的技术栈,并按照系统设计文档进行开发。主要步骤包括:
- 环境搭建:搭建开发和测试环境,确保开发过程的顺利进行。
- 前端开发:使用HTML、CSS、JavaScript等技术开发用户界面,确保系统的易用性和美观性。
- 后端开发:使用Java、Python、Node.js等后端技术实现业务逻辑和数据处理。
- 数据库开发:使用SQL或NoSQL数据库存储和管理发票数据。
- 接口开发:实现系统与其他系统或模块的接口,确保数据的互通和共享。
四、测试与部署
测试与部署是确保系统稳定性和可靠性的关键步骤,主要包括:
- 单元测试:对系统的各个功能模块进行单元测试,确保其正确性和稳定性。
- 集成测试:对系统的整体功能进行集成测试,确保各个模块之间的协调和配合。
- 性能测试:对系统的性能进行测试,确保其在高并发和大数据量情况下的稳定性。
- 用户验收测试:邀请用户进行系统验收测试,确保系统满足用户的需求。
- 系统部署:将系统部署到生产环境,确保系统的正常运行。
五、持续优化
在系统上线后,需要进行持续优化,主要包括:
- 用户反馈收集:通过收集用户反馈,了解系统的不足之处,进行相应的改进。
- 性能优化:通过监控系统的性能,及时进行优化,确保系统的高效运行。
- 功能扩展:根据用户需求,不断扩展系统的功能,提升用户体验。
- 安全升级:及时更新系统的安全策略,确保数据的安全和隐私保护。
总结以上步骤,开发合思发票智能校验系统不仅需要明确的需求分析和合理的系统设计,还需要选择合适的技术栈和进行充分的测试与优化。通过这些步骤,可以确保系统的高效性、稳定性和可扩展性,从而满足用户的实际需求。
相关问答FAQs:
合思发票智能校验系统开发解决方案的主要功能是什么?
合思发票智能校验系统是一款集成了先进技术的发票管理工具,旨在提升发票处理的效率和准确性。该系统的主要功能包括:
-
自动数据识别与提取:利用OCR(光学字符识别)技术,系统能够快速识别发票上的关键信息,并自动提取数据。这一过程不仅节省了人工输入的时间,也大大降低了因手动输入而导致的错误。
-
智能校验与比对:系统可以将提取的发票信息与数据库中的历史记录进行比对,确保发票的真实性和有效性。这一功能能够有效防范发票造假和虚开发票的风险。
-
实时监控与报告生成:合思系统支持实时监控发票的状态,用户可以随时查看发票处理的进展。同时,系统还可以根据不同的需求生成各类报告,帮助企业进行财务分析和决策。
-
多种发票格式支持:该系统能够支持多种类型的发票,包括增值税普通发票、增值税专用发票、电子发票等,满足不同企业的需求。
-
用户友好的界面:系统的用户界面设计简洁直观,使得用户可以快速上手,减少了培训的时间和成本。
通过这些功能,合思发票智能校验系统能够极大提高企业的发票管理效率,降低人工成本,并确保财务数据的准确性。
合思发票智能校验系统的技术架构是怎样的?
合思发票智能校验系统的技术架构采用了现代化的设计理念,主要包括以下几个层次:
-
数据采集层:这一层负责将用户上传的发票数据进行初步处理,包括图像预处理和数据格式转换。通过使用高效的图像处理算法,系统可以提高OCR识别的准确率,确保后续数据提取的有效性。
-
数据处理层:在这一层,系统应用了机器学习和自然语言处理技术,对提取到的发票信息进行智能分析和校验。通过训练模型,系统能够识别出不同类型发票的特征,从而进行更精确的校验。
-
业务逻辑层:这一层负责系统的核心业务逻辑,包括发票的校验规则、比对算法和异常处理机制。系统能够根据用户设置的规则,自动识别出潜在的风险发票,并及时提醒用户。
-
数据存储层:合思发票智能校验系统采用了高性能的数据库,支持大数据量的存储和检索。系统能够快速响应用户的查询请求,并保证数据的安全性和一致性。
-
用户界面层:系统提供了友好的用户界面,用户可以通过网页或移动端进行操作。界面设计遵循人性化原则,确保用户体验流畅。
通过这样完善的技术架构,合思发票智能校验系统能够高效、稳定地运行,为企业提供可靠的发票管理解决方案。
合思发票智能校验系统为企业带来了哪些实际价值?
合思发票智能校验系统在实际应用中为企业带来了显著的价值,主要体现在以下几个方面:
-
提升工作效率:传统的发票处理往往需要大量的人工操作,容易导致效率低下。通过自动化的发票识别和校验,合思系统能够显著减少人工干预,提升发票处理的速度,帮助企业节省大量的时间和人力资源。
-
降低操作风险:由于人工输入容易出现错误,合思系统通过智能校验功能,能够有效识别和预警可能存在的问题发票,降低了财务风险。企业能够更加安心地进行财务管理,避免因发票问题而导致的法律纠纷和经济损失。
-
优化财务管理:系统能够提供实时的数据分析和报告生成功能,帮助企业更好地掌握财务状况,做出更为精准的决策。通过对发票数据的深入分析,企业可以发现潜在的财务问题,及时采取措施进行调整。
-
支持合规性审计:合思发票智能校验系统能够确保发票的真实性和有效性,符合国家税务政策和合规要求。这一功能帮助企业在接受审计时提供可靠的证据,减少合规风险。
-
增强客户满意度:在客户服务方面,企业可以通过快速处理发票,提高对客户的响应速度,从而提升客户的满意度和信任度。这对于企业的长期发展和客户关系维护至关重要。
通过这些实际价值的体现,合思发票智能校验系统不仅为企业带来了经济效益,还促进了企业的可持续发展。